Gen. Natakani’s Visit To India: Scaling Up India-Japan Defence Ties – Analysis

Eurasia Review Friday, 9 May 2025 ()
Japan’s Defence Minister General Nakatani paid a four-day visit to India 3 May 2025 that also took him to Sri Lanka to discuss bilateral defence cooperation and regional security.

In his discussion with the Indian counterpart Rajnath Singh, Gen Natakani touched the concerning Pahalgam terror attack and expressed solidarity...
